Russia's Attack on Ukraine Violates Polish Airspace
Russian forces launched a new deadly strike on Ukraine, during which an unidentified object entered Polish airspace before descending into a field. The incursion was detected by Polish air defence systems, which tracked the object until it impacted, causing no casualties but raising concerns about cross‑border security.
In response,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ky appealed to international partners for the deployment of anti‑ballistic missile systems to counter what he described as “Russian terror.” The European Union has condemned the attack, calling it a violation of international law and a threat to regional stability. The EU’s statement reaffirmed its commitment to supporting Ukraine’s defense and urged further cooperation to prevent future incidents.
